One Injured After Falling 40 Feet

This incident occurred in the early morning hours of August 10.

(Carroll County, Ky.) – Around 1:00 a.m. on August 10, deputies with the Carroll County Sheriff’s Office responded to an unknown type of trouble call near I-71.

Upon arrival, further investigation found that a Northbound driver hit the bridge near KY 227 and dropped approximately 40 feet to the railroad tracks below.

The driver was flown to the University Hospital for treatment of injuries.
